I want to get the user information from the twitter and show in windows phone 7. I found some examples for twitter integration.
But in this examples i can only login to the twitter. I can not post or can not get the user information. Can any one provide a sample application or links for windows phone 7 twitter integration.
After getting login i try like this:
private void btntest_Click(object sender, RoutedEventArgs e)
{
string newURL = string.Format("https://api.twitter.com/1.1/users/show.json?screen_name={0}", userScreenName);
WebClient webClient = new WebClient();
webClient.DownloadStringCompleted += new DownloadStringCompletedEventHandler(webBrowser_Navigated);
webClient.DownloadStringAsync(new Uri(newURL));
}
void webBrowser_Navigated(object sender, DownloadStringCompletedEventArgs e)
{
if (e.Error != null)
{
Console.WriteLine("Error ");
return;
}
Console.WriteLine("Result==> " + e.Result);
//List<Tweet> tweets = JsonConvert.DeserializeObject<List<Tweet>>(e.Result);
//this.lbTweets.ItemsSource = tweets;
}
But here i can not get the user information. Please help me to get the user infoemation.

Finally i found the Solution..!!! :-)
public void GetTwitterDetail(string _userScreenName)
{
var credentials = new OAuthCredentials
{
Type = OAuthType.ProtectedResource,
SignatureMethod = OAuthSignatureMethod.HmacSha1,
ParameterHandling = OAuthParameterHandling.HttpAuthorizationHeader,
ConsumerKey = AppSettings.consumerKey,
ConsumerSecret = AppSettings.consumerKeySecret,
Token = this.accessToken,
TokenSecret = this.accessTokenSecret,
};
var restClient = new RestClient
{
Authority = "https://api.twitter.com/1.1",
HasElevatedPermissions = true
};
var restRequest = new RestRequest
{
Credentials = credentials,
Path = string.Format("/users/show.json?screen_name={0}&include_entities=true", _userScreenName),
Method = WebMethod.Get
};
restClient.BeginRequest(restRequest, new RestCallback(test));
}
private void test(RestRequest request, RestResponse response, object obj)
{
Deployment.Current.Dispatcher.BeginInvoke(() =>
{
Console.WriteLine("Content==> " + response.Content.ToString());
Console.WriteLine("StatusCode==> " + response.StatusCode);
});
}
